Magellan Financial Group's FY2026 results mark a potential inflection point for the Australian asset manager following one of the industry's most dramatic funds outflow cycles. The company, once Australia's premier active global equity manager, suffered severe reputation damage and performance-related outflows after a high-profile management departure in 2022. The FY2026 results, including commentary on Barrenjoey and FUM trajectory, are being closely watched for confirmation that the turnaround under new management is gaining traction.

The Barrenjoey partnership โ€” Magellan's investment in a boutique investment bank co-founded with Barrenjoey's management team โ€” represents a strategic diversification away from pure-play asset management into advisory and capital markets. Barrenjoey has established itself as a credible boutique in the competitive Australian investment banking market, winning mandates in M&A advisory and equity capital markets. Any improvement in Barrenjoey's contribution to Magellan's consolidated earnings reduces the group's dependence on volatile FUM-linked management fees.

For Magellan investors, the critical metrics to monitor are net fund flows per quarter, investment performance relative to benchmark across its global equity strategies, and management fee rate trends as the FUM mix shifts. The stock's recovery from its post-2022 lows depends on sustained FUM stabilization followed by genuine net inflows, which have historically taken 12-24 months to materialize following a major asset manager's reputation recovery. The FY2026 results appear to represent the early stages of that recovery arc.
